Myanmar Revealed: Life Along the Irrawaddy River
For additional exploration of Myanmar’s many charms, we are pleased to announce this new overland adventure led by Asia expert, Gary Wintz. Spend a full week cruising along the Irrawaddy River, with stops at small villages and local markets seldom visited by Westerners, as well as ancient Tagaung, believed to be the first capital of Myanmar. The medieval capital of Mrauk U possesses a rich collection of temples and pagodas second only to Bagan. Make stops in the bustling cities of Yangon and Mandalay to discover stunning architecture and important religious sites.
Wild Mongolia with Kevin Clement
With Zegrahm field director, Kevin Clement, explore the world’s largest intact prairie to search for herds of argali sheep, Siberian ibex, and Mongolian gazelle, as well as the corsac fox, Pallas’s cat, and cinereous vulture. Visit with local families to learn about their traditional nomadic lifestyle that has changed little over the centuries. Ancient Silk Road: China, Kazakhstan & Uzbekistan
Begin your comprehensive China tour in Beijing with a private rickshaw ride through the old quarters of this ancient town. In Xi’an, visit the world-famous army of Terra Cotta Warriors, a highlight of Chinese adventure travel. Wander through the Kashgar Sunday market which attracts traders from all over Central Asia. Then venture farther west for your Kazakhstan expedition and the cultural capital of the region, Tashkent, and enter the forbidden city of Khiva—a UNESCO World Heritage Site.
